Pop Pop is a northeastern name for a grandfather. I had never heard it in my life (or Mom Mom) until we lived in PA. I even have a neighbor from PA who is “Mom Mom” and I smile when I think about how it is so commonplace in that area and not at all known down here. We usually hear names like: Nana, Grammy, Meemaw (which I don’t care for), or Grandma. My Mother is Nana, and her husband is Papa. My husband’s mother is Grandma Mary.
